There are several variants of ice fishing shelters available in the market and selecting the best one can be daunting some times. Here are some factors you must consider while choosing the best ice shelter that meets your needs.
Type: What is your ideal type? Do you prefer cabin style or a flip-up tent?
Capacity: How much space do you really need inside the ice shelter?
Price: What is your budget?
Storage: How much space do you need to store your equipment and gear?
Weight: Do you intend to carry your shelter and move it around a lot?
Portability: Does the Eskimo ice fishing shelter need to fit into a car or are you willing to tow it?
Denier: Do you prefer nylon or polyester fabric?

Eskimo Fatfish 949i Review
The Eskimo Fatfish 949i pop-up portable ice fishing shelter offers a unique hub design, reliable YKK zippers, ice anchors that do not bend under heavy pressure, and quality fabric for heavy-duty durability and the lifespan you need, even in harsh winter conditions.
The Eskimo Fatfish 949i comes with the set-up dimensions of 4x94x80 inches and features 6 large removable windows. It is capable of accommodating up to 4 persons. The Eskimo FatFish 949i gives you 80% more fishable area than other ice shelters in its class. It features an extra insulated layer to protect you from the freezing cold.
The Fatfish 949 utilizes and IQ insulated fabric which gives the fisherman 35% more warmth in the harshest of conditions. This pop-up shelter features rugged, durable fabric that can withstand the elements and protect you from the toughest weather condition. Its high-quality YKK zipper prevents cold and the wind from penetrating the ice hut. During out tests with this great ice house, we stayed cozy and comfortable the entire time.
The Eskimo Fatfish 949i shelter also features self-tapping ice anchors which we found easy to grip and they never bent under pressure. According to Eskimo, their IceTight fabric has a 59% higher thread count that results in a tighter weave, and therefore offers complete protection against wind and water. The strategically placed door offers more space inside the ice hut.
This portable ice shelter fits into an over-sized duffle bag that can be easily toted around. It offers enough space to store all of your essential fishing gears. We found space to be more than adequate. The Eskimo FatFish 949 comes with two doors on the opposite sides of the ice shack to allow fishermen easy in and out access.
